- Containers in OpenStack
- Pradeep Kumar Singh Madhuri Kumari
- 240字
- 2021-07-02 21:17:23
Clear container
Virtual machines are secure but very expensive and slow to start, whereas containers are fast and provide a more efficient alternative, but are less secure. Intel's Clear containers are a trade-off solution between hypervisor-based VMs and Linux containers that offer agility similar to that of conventional Linux containers, while also offering the hardware-enforced workload isolation of hypervisor-based VMs.
A Clear container is a container wrapped in its own inpidual ultra-fast, trimmed down VM which offers security and efficiency. The Clear container model uses a fast and lightweight QEMU hypervisor that has been optimized to reduce memory footprints and improve startup performance. It has also optimized, in the kernel, the systemd and core user space for minimal memory consumption. These features improve the resource utilization efficiency significantly and offer enhanced security and speed compared to traditional VMs.
Intel Clear containers provide a lightweight mechanism to isolate the guest environment from the host and also provide hardware-based enforcement for workload isolation. Moreover, the OS layer is shared transparently and securely from the host into the address space of each Intel Clear container, providing an optimal combination of high security with low overhead.
With the security and agility enhancements offered by Clear containers, they have seen a high adoption rate. Today, they seamlessly integrate with the Docker project with the added protection of Intel VT. Intel and CoreOS have collaborated closely to incorporate Clear containers into CoreOS's Rocket (Rkt) container runtime.
- Mastering Mesos
- AutoCAD快速入門與工程制圖
- 三菱FX3U/5U PLC從入門到精通
- 商戰數據挖掘:你需要了解的數據科學與分析思維
- 樂高機器人EV3設計指南:創造者的搭建邏輯
- 影視后期制作(Avid Media Composer 5.0)
- 西門子變頻器技術入門及實踐
- Visual FoxPro程序設計
- 電腦上網輕松入門
- 網絡服務搭建、配置與管理大全(Linux版)
- 數據要素:全球經濟社會發展的新動力
- 運動控制系統(第2版)
- Raspberry Pi 3 Projects for Java Programmers
- 我的IT世界
- Machine Learning with R Quick Start Guide